Total Triathlon Almanac - 5

Item Description
The Total Triathlon Almanac-5 is a comprehensive logbook and a basic training primer. Building on the four earlier standard-setting editions, it is light weight and "pared down to the bones"-a flexible year-long training companion.
The almanac saves time for the experienced athlete. For the newer participant, it is a foundation for establishing a successful program which conforms to current advances in exercise physiology, training and race preparation. For all, it's an indispensable year-round organizer, record keeper and information source.
The weekly log pages now have twice the room to write.
Includes motivational full-page color pictures of world-class triathletes in full racing action by the Official Ironman Triathlon Photographer.
You will learn from world class triathletes and triathlon authorities how to:
Prevent burnout and injury
Live healthier and race faster
Train with a heart rate monitor
Improve your strength, speed and endurance
Assemble the building blocks of a training program
Prepare, taper and peak for a race of any distance
Develop a mental training program called "Mind Power"
Contributors providing training and racing information for this edition include:
Mark Allen, a six-time winner of the Ironman Triathlon World Championship
Eric Bean, an Ironman Triathlon World Championship age group winner from 1998, a 2003 Collegiate National Champion and the current Stanford University Triathlon Team coach
Thomas Hellriegel, a multiple Ironman Triathlon winner, including the Ironman Triathlon World Championship
Joy Leutner (nee Hansen), a former world-class Olympic distance triathlete
Dr. Phil Maffetone, nutrition coach to numerous top athletes
Paula Newby-Fraser, an eight-time winner of the Ironman Triathlon World Championship and the only woman to break nine hours in Kona; has achieved an incomprehensible 24 career Ironman victories across the globe
Seppo Nuuttila, former coach of the Finnish National Track & Field Team and several Olympic and professional endurance athletes, including rowers, runners and triathletes
Dave Scott, a six-timer winner of the Ironman Triathlon World Championship
